上一页 1 ··· 16 17 18 19 20 21 22 23 24 ··· 31 下一页
摘要: 野火这部分内容不如正点原子,本文来自正点原子Linux第31章《Uboot顶层Makefile详解》。 1. uboot 目录结构简介: 最重要的三个文件夹:ABC 1. 文件夹arch:存放关于CPU架构的代码 2. 文件夹board:存放关于特定开发板的代码 3. 文件夹configs:存放ub 阅读全文
posted @ 2023-05-18 11:03 FBshark 阅读(212) 评论(0) 推荐(0) 编辑
摘要: 0. emmc标准 eMMC是 embedded MultiMediaCard 的简称,即嵌入式多媒体卡, 是一种闪存卡的标准。 它定义了基于嵌入式多媒体卡的存储系统的物理架构和访问接口及协议,具体由电子设备工程联合委员会JEDEC订立和发布。它是对MMC的一个拓展,具有体积小,功耗低,容量大等优点 阅读全文
posted @ 2023-05-16 23:26 FBshark 阅读(1282) 评论(0) 推荐(0) 编辑
摘要: 1. git config 当我们安装了 git 后,一件非常重要的事情就是配置我们的用户名和邮箱地址,因为我们提交代码到远端服务器需要通过它们来得知提交者是谁。 查看配置列表在配置用户信息前,我们需要确定自己是否已配置了用户信息。 我们先查看所有的配置: git config --list 配置分 阅读全文
posted @ 2023-05-15 16:34 FBshark 阅读(25) 评论(0) 推荐(0) 编辑
摘要: 1. 重烧录SD卡Raspbian系统 SD卡/U盘刷系统后容量“变小”问题 转载自:http://www.taodudu.cc/news.html 如果你使用的SD卡之前烧录过其他系统,比如树莓派系统,这时你会发现,由于SD卡之前烧录了其他系统镜像,其显示的容量变小了。比如明明是16G,现在显示才 阅读全文
posted @ 2023-05-14 20:40 FBshark 阅读(44) 评论(0) 推荐(0) 编辑
摘要: 查找命令 1、/ 命令 【命令格式】:/string,string为要查找的字符。 【命令作用】:光标处开始向后寻找字符串 string。向后就是向光标所在位置处行数增大的方向寻找。 2、?命令 【命令格式】:?string,string为要查找的字符。 【命令作用】:光标处开始向前寻找字符串 st 阅读全文
posted @ 2023-05-13 16:49 FBshark 阅读(2314) 评论(0) 推荐(0) 编辑
摘要: 首先,要说野火的linux驱动的pdf做得不是很好,代码内容匆匆略过。 后来才发现野火有专门的网页,这是驱动部分的章节 : https://doc.embedfire.com/lubancat/build_and_deploy/zh/latest/index.html 代码都可以下载!!! 预备:下 阅读全文
posted @ 2023-05-13 15:50 FBshark 阅读(639) 评论(0) 推荐(0) 编辑
摘要: 一、普通元器件 ①二极管 1. 二极管具有正向导通特性,但需要一定的门槛,称为门槛电压。锗为0.2V,硅为0.6V 2. 实际的二极管具有压降,这个压降称为正向压降。锗为0.3V,硅为0.7V 3. 二极管的管芯分为点接触、面接触和平面型。这直接影响其允许通过的电流。 4. 二极管最重要的参数:最大 阅读全文
posted @ 2023-05-09 17:35 FBshark 阅读(94) 评论(0) 推荐(0) 编辑
摘要: 一、消息队列 ①学习各种不熟悉的函数 1. strncmp() 库文件:string.h strncmp函数为字符串比较函数,字符串大小的比较是以ASCII 码表上的顺序来决定,此顺序亦为字符的值。其函数声明为 int strncmp ( const char * str1, const char 阅读全文
posted @ 2023-05-08 22:34 FBshark 阅读(34) 评论(0) 推荐(0) 编辑
摘要: SSH服务器配置 参考:https://blog.csdn.net/weixin_43833430/article/details/127262464 《Ubuntu安装SSH服务》 目的:在 Unbuntu 中,安装openssh 服务器,开启服务器;安装防火墙,配置防火墙参数(可以通过SSH), 阅读全文
posted @ 2023-05-02 11:18 FBshark 阅读(74) 评论(0) 推荐(0) 编辑
摘要: Linux 操作基础 1. git 下载文档: 在一个文件夹中右键点击 Git Bash here,打开一个终端窗口: 在窗口中输入: git clone https://e.coding.net/weidongshan/01_all_series_quickstart.git 另外,可以用图中 g 阅读全文
posted @ 2023-05-01 22:40 FBshark 阅读(63) 评论(0) 推荐(0) 编辑
摘要: 使用inline函数可以提升程序效率,但是让inline函数生效是有条件的... 打开 Linux 内核源代码,会发现内核在定义C语言函数时,有很多都带有 “inline”关键字,请看下图,那么这个关键字有什么作用呢? inline 关键字的作用 在C语言程序开发中,inline 一般用于定义函数, 阅读全文
posted @ 2023-04-29 13:00 FBshark 阅读(1576) 评论(0) 推荐(1) 编辑
摘要: 【文章1】为何众多计算机语言要从1970年1月1日开始算起? 记得刚搭好sspanel的时候看到用户注册时间都是1970年,不懂代码的我看到下面这篇文章终于了解了是什么原因,当然程序员肯定知道的。 为什么计算机时间和众多编程语言的时间都要从1970年1月1日开始算起呢,时间计时起点到底为什么是197 阅读全文
posted @ 2023-04-28 10:30 FBshark 阅读(158) 评论(0) 推荐(0) 编辑
摘要: 1. 避障模式 今天尝试编写避障模式, 常规思路就是读取 HC-SR04 的值进行判断,如果读到的数值小于某个值(比如10cm), 车子就后退;如果数值大于这个值,那么车子就停止。 在这个过程中我犯了两个错误。 一个是忘记了做BSP测试的时候,HC-SR04 用到定时器和电机输出的 PWM 定时器是 阅读全文
posted @ 2023-04-25 16:52 FBshark 阅读(97) 评论(0) 推荐(0) 编辑
摘要: STM32F103的默认测试端口(JTAG\SW)介绍 STM32F103的PB3、PB4、PA13、PA14、PA15在默认上电状态并不是具有普通 IO 的功能的。而是用作 SWJ-DP端口(用于JTAG调试) 这些引脚只有重定义功能后才能作为普通的IO口使用,所以我们需要对这些引脚进行配置的时候 阅读全文
posted @ 2023-04-23 14:25 FBshark 阅读(671) 评论(0) 推荐(0) 编辑
摘要: 简要概括 1. 尺寸不同:14500说明直徑14mm长度50mm的圆柱状电池,18650是直徑18mm长度65mm的圆柱状电池。 2. 容量通常不同:14500电池由于容量相对来说小,最基本的容量一般在600mAh-800mAh正中间,比较大的容量一般也不会超过900mAh。18650电池的最基本容 阅读全文
posted @ 2023-04-22 09:18 FBshark 阅读(1650) 评论(0) 推荐(0) 编辑
上一页 1 ··· 16 17 18 19 20 21 22 23 24 ··· 31 下一页